  • Abstract
    In the remanufacturing industry, customer demands and product returns always display irregular intermittent patterns. It is very difficult to accurately forecast such customer demands and product returns. This paper conducts a comparative assessment of the forecasts derived by various methods, and evaluates the robustness of forecasting methodology through the demand data from a remanufacturing company. The results show the econometric methods are more accurate than the classic methods in terms of the mean squared error (MSE).
